Razer Unveilings At GamesCom 2009

Razer, today announced the Razer Naga and the Razer Megasoma at GamesCom 2009.

The Razer Naga is the next level in gaming mice for MMO players, tested in participation with leading MMO gamers and community sites; it gives gamers the competitive edge. Also showcasing at GamesCom is the Razer Megasoma, a premium hybrid gaming mouse mat that combines all the best features of a hard and soft mouse mat into one.

Razer Naga

The Razer Naga MMO gaming mouse provides uniquely innovative gameplay features. The Razer Naga’s customizable interface allows gamers to program and command the mouse in-game to fit their specific needs. Razer understands the critical features of the keyboard commands in MMO interfaces; the slightest delay or mistake that occurs in raids and arenas can result in a fatal outcome. The Razer Naga’s distinctive 12 button thumb grid is designed to aid gamers by eliminating excessive clicking on the keyboard spell keys (1 through 12) while freeing up the hands to focus on movement and modifier keys. The Razer Naga is designed to offer a different approach to gaming with instant access to many commands at the click of your thumb, making it more convenient and accessible.

The Razer Naga’s add-on software, in conjunction with the supported titles, enables gamers to save unlimited profiles and program thousands of different in-game commands for each character you choose to play without the hassle of remapping every time you re-spec. The ergonomic form factor gives players comfort and optimized control to every button. Razer’s engineers have raised the bar as the new interfaces of this gaming mouse bridges the gap between the game, peripheral and the user with customization, stimulating interaction and easy control.

COST: USD ($79.99) EUR (€79.99)

AVAILABILITY: Worldwide

Technical Specifications:

  • 5600dpi Razer Precision 3.5G Laser Sensor
  • 1000Hz Ultrapolling / 1ms response time
  • 200 inches per second max tracking speed
  • Zero-acoustic Ultraslick Teflon feet
  • 17 MMO-optimized buttons (including 12 button thumb grid)
  • Optional MMO-specific software AddOns
  • Unlimited character profiles with AddOns

Approximate size: 116L x 69W x 41.6H (in mm)

Razer Megasoma

The Razer Megasoma is designed solely to achieve one goal; to bring all the best features — accuracy, comfort, flexibility, durability, and portability — of a hard and soft mat into one gaming mouse mat.

The Razer Megasoma is constructed to be a hybrid gaming mouse mat that fuses superior tracking and ultra-durability of a hard mat but also the smooth glide of a soft mat.

The composition of the Razer Megasoma is engineered with highly durable translucent silicone allowing gamers to roll it up and take it to LAN parties.

The sleek white surface and illuminating embedded logo adds a nice, aesthetic touch.

COST: USD ($49.99) EUR (€49.99)

AVAILABILITY: Worldwide

Features:

  • Exclusive ambient glow
  • Optimal performance for both laser and optical mice
  • Silicon Mouse Mat for pinpoint precise tracking and optimal grip
  • Extra large mouse mat suited for most gaming environments: 350 X 230 X 2 mm
